And as a squishy Mara, flying into a fight and Smash critting people is fun and all, but people will be after you in that situation and you have little survivabiity.

 

Maras aren't squishy. The class has better durability than any class in the game short of a full tank spec and geared PT or tank Assassin.

 

Furthermore, Rage spec has +7% passive damage reduction over Annihilation (3% internal/bleed over Anni). Nevermind the potential abuse of a 45s UR.

 

In a group cluster****, Rage has both more survivability and effectiveness.

 

Anni is stronger for, as you say, humping a healer or solo target while not being cluster****ed by 5 players.

 

Rage also requires much less raw contact time for its damage execution, allowing the Marauder to joust a bit and better manage the 5 players from a spatial standpoint.

 

Edit:

 

Annihilation is more suited to pug solo queue play than Rage by a significant margin, however:

 

1. Pug solo queue trends to players on your team sucking and not dealing with healers appropriately. Annihilation spec healer-hump is a great solution to this problem.

 

2. Maps like Huttball in a pug trend towards blitz ball caps where a solo hero Assassin or Jugg run across the whole map (again because you/your team is bad). With more "premade" work and more skill overall, this tends to drag, and the ball carrier will more often be surround by allies attempting to protect them. This meta leans towards Rage spec for clearing space.
